A leading healthcare provider in the UK is looking for a Bank Registered Nurse to support residents in a care home. The role involves caring for residents' physical, psychological, and social needs while developing personalized care plans and ensuring safety.
Candidates should possess current NMC registration and experience in nursing. This position offers flexible working hours, along with opportunities for professional development and valuable support in a rewarding environment.
